ZIP 87319 and ZIP 87328 are ZIP Code areas in New Mexico.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 87319 has the higher population (3,205 vs 3,017 in ZIP 87328). ZIP 87319 has the higher median household income ($38,508 vs $29,833 in ZIP 87328). ZIP 87328 has the higher median home value ($60,500 vs $29,600 in ZIP 87319).
